Skip to content

Commit

Permalink
Avoid setdefault
Browse files Browse the repository at this point in the history
  • Loading branch information
khvn26 committed Dec 18, 2023
1 parent 48cb88b commit a52efad
Showing 1 changed file with 3 additions and 5 deletions.
8 changes: 3 additions & 5 deletions api/features/features_service.py
Original file line number Diff line number Diff line change
Expand Up @@ -100,10 +100,8 @@ def get_edge_overrides_data(
if feature_state.feature_segment_id:
env_feature_overrides_data.num_segment_overrides += 1
for identity_override in get_overrides_data_future.result():
env_feature_overrides_data = all_overrides_data.setdefault(
identity_override.feature_state.feature.id,
EnvironmentFeatureOverridesData(),
)
env_feature_overrides_data.add_identity_override()
all_overrides_data[
identity_override.feature_state.feature.id
].add_identity_override()

return all_overrides_data

0 comments on commit a52efad

Please sign in to comment.